Ver Mensaje Individual
  #3 (permalink)  
Antiguo 28/01/2007, 13:59
Suyta
(Desactivado)
 
Fecha de Ingreso: septiembre-2004
Mensajes: 360
Antigüedad: 19 años, 7 meses
Puntos: 1
Re: Timeout en fsockopen

Gracias DeeR

Me cuesta entender esto. A ver ?
Lo que yo quiero es establecer un tiempo máximo para la conexión... si el sitio al que envío el request está muy lento y pasan más de 10 segundos x ejemplo para abrir... cerrar la conexión.
Ahora por lo me dices en mi:
Código PHP:
$fp["$url"] = fsockopen $hostip80$errno$hostip30 ); 
El 30 es mi floal timeout ... es así ?
Pero en ese caso lo que yo veo en la práctica es que no lo respeta porque si el sitio donde apunto está lento se queda 'tildado' el script... no cierra la conexión.
Intenté también son stream_set_timeout pero no es aceptado por mi server, tira error (he leído por ahí que esto sucede pero no se explica muy bien por qué o cómo solucionarlo)
Alguna idea ?
Cariños